Written by top practitioners, Adverse Actions and Performance-Based Actions is a thorough examination of the governing statutes, case law, and processes that agencies are obligated to follow in taking adverse and performance-based actions. Key terms and the implementation process of disciplinary action are clearly defined—including all steps and timelines to be adhered to. The authors share their insights through strategy hints, practice tips, key checklists, samples, and step-by-step advice on how to take effective adverse actions and performance-based actions. Each section is divided by individual actions and examines all substantive and procedural issues: what is covered, who is covered, what are the issues, and what must happen to prevail.
